Narrow streets, also known as closes, run between buildings along the Royal Mile and other streets in the historic Old Town. These provide access to buildings and entrances behind buildings that are fronted by street. Some of these closed have been restored and made public. Some of them are named after famous people in the past, like Mary King's Close.

One of the main reasons is that the actions to lower the speed limit to 20mph have led to lower speeds. In a study of the entire city there was a statistically significant decrease in mean speed was noted twelve months after the introduction. A shift in the distribution of overall speeds was also observed, with a decrease in both higher and lower speeds. The reductions were comparable to those observed in studies of 20mph zones, although there isn't as much evidence to support the effectiveness of these zones at an urban or town level.

These results support the theory stating that reducing the average speed can improve urban environments. This could be due to the reduction in casualties and collisions or by the impact on broader aspects like liveability.
